Lungs Cairo premier is performed by The Caravan Group. A play written by Duncan Macmillan and directed by Effat Yehia.
It is a journey into the world of a couple, M and W, who live in London. In an attempt to make a family, they explore their relationship, themselves, their responsibilities, the world we live in, and its disasters, from pandemics to economic collapse. A play that questions the fabric of relationships and the future of the new generations

Gareema Fel Maadi, Masraheya Kolaha Ghalat (A Crime in Maadi, The Play that Goes Wrong), a play performed by a group of budding actors trained by comedian Ashraf Abdel-Baky, who is also the director. The Play That Goes Wrong is an English play that won the highest awards in British and American theatres including the Lawrence Oliver and Tony Awards in 2015 and 2017 respectively. It is also considered to be one of the best onstage comedies since its creation in 2014. Abdel-Baky flew to The Mischief Theatre Company in London, acquired the performing rights to the play, and translated it into Egyptian Arabic. The Egyptian version is now showing under the title, Gareema Fel Maadi, Masraheya Kolaha Ghalat with two separate casts. Abdel-Baky, together with the group of actors have personally renovated the theatre recently and was able to restore its essence and former glory

Alsandouq (The Box), a play produced by Taliaa Theatre Company. In an absurd comical style, the play revolves around a group of people in a crisis, all locked in one unidentified place and they don't know each other but have one dream which is to get out of this place. The play is an adaptation of Taha Sadat's story Dreams of Dolls. It features actors Yasser Altobgy, Nasser Shahin, Taha Khalifa, Amira Abdel-Rahman, décor and costumes designed by Fady Foukiya, with music composed by Hassan Zaki and directed by Reda Hassanein
